Abstract
Aircraft hydraulic systems have operated at 3000 psi for many years. The hydraulic power within the aircraft however has consistently increased for each generation of aircraft. Higher pressure hydraulics has been studied based upon the smaller volume and lighter weight of the higher pressure hydraulics.
The Model A/F27T-10 Hydraulic Component Test Stand is designed to provide the capability to test high pressure aircraft hydraulic components up to and including 8000 psi. The Test Stand is capable of automatic or fully independent manual operation and is designed for use in intermediate level activities in land based, ship board, or mobile van facilities.
